Almost all cars that received registration were imported from abroad — 96.9% of the market, which in quantitative terms amounts to 5,570 units. In contrast, cars assembled in Ukraine accounted for only 3.1% — that is 179 units. The corresponding statistics were provided by analysts of the Institute of Car Market Research.

In the brand ranking, no changes occurred: the most frequent new registrations were for Toyota, Volkswagen, Skoda, and Renault. Similar stability is observed among specific models — the most popular among dealers were the Renault Duster and Toyota RAV4 crossovers. The top ten mostly included SUVs, which once again emphasizes Ukrainians' preference for spacious and multifunctional cars.

Special attention is paid to domestic production. In the category of cars marked as assembled in Ukraine, the undisputed leader was the Skoda Karoq — 93 such SUVs rolled off the assembly line of the Eurocar plant operating in Transcarpathia. The second position was taken by the Skoda Octavia, of which 23 were counted — they are also a product of local assembly. The third line was occupied by the Toyota RAV4 (9 units), which underwent a conversion procedure into special versions. The rest of the list consisted of models that domestic enterprises adapted for the needs of the police, medical sector, and other customers.
